Long-term conditions people report.
28.9% of residents in SA1 35012 live with a long-term health condition — around the middle of the range (above both the Victoria average of 27.4% and the national 27.7%). 10.2% of people in SA1 35012 report a mental health condition, above average (above both the Victoria average of 8.8% and the national 8.8%).
The most common long-term health conditions reported is Asthma at 12%, ahead of Mental health (10%).

People needing help with daily activities.
5.0% of residents in SA1 35012 need help with daily activities — around the middle of the range (below both the Victoria average of 5.9% and the national 5.8%).
